    I can see silhouettes of snow people on level 30 (up to snowman family 5), so what does that mean?

    My current happiness value is 13. What does that mean?

    The picture on my calendar is still the tiny snowman, so am I still working to get the simplest deco?
    The decos in the tower are always silhouttes until you own them and build them on your farm to unlock them.

    Collecting snowballs increases the happiness of the deco that you win at the end of the event - so far you have collected enough to get a deco with happiness 13.

    The picture on your calendar shows which deco you would win if the event ended now.

    As you get more happiness, the picture changes to a better & better deco & when you have happiness 43 you will be up to the Snowman Family & you can just continue to add more happiness to that (by collecting snowballs) until the event ends & you win that deco.
